Cabin Floor Refinishing in Kansas City, KS
Cabin floor refinishing services involve restoring and renewing wooden floors in cabins, lodges, or similar properties to enhance their appearance and durability. This process typically includes sanding away old finishes, repairing minor damage, and applying new stain or protective coatings. Property owners often request this service for projects such as updating aged or worn floors, preparing a cabin for sale, or improving the overall aesthetic of a rustic or natural interior.
Before requesting cabin floor refinishing, property owners usually want to understand the scope of work involved, including the condition of the existing flooring and the types of finishes available. It is also helpful to consider the desired look-whether a natural wood finish or a specific stain-and to be aware of any potential disruptions during the refinishing process. Clarifying these details can ensure the project meets expectations and results in a durable, attractive floor that complements the property's style.

Cabin Floor Refinishing Questions
What is involved in cabin floor refinishing? The process typically includes sanding the existing surface, repairing any damage, and applying a new finish to enhance appearance and durability.
Can refinishing improve the appearance of my cabin’s floors? Yes, refinishing can restore the natural beauty of the wood, reduce scratches, and give the floors a fresh, updated look.
Is cabin floor refinishing suitable for all types of wood floors? Most hardwood floors can be refinished, but some softer or damaged floors may require special treatment or replacement.
What benefits does refinishing provide compared to replacing floors? Refinishing extends the life of existing floors, improves aesthetics, and is generally more cost-effective than full replacement.
